MUMBAI: Home shopping channel Best Deal TV, owned by Bollywood star Akshay Kumar and Raj Kundra, will not be available on direct-to-home (DTH) platform Reliance Digital TV due to termination of contract by the broadcaster. The DTH operator has issued a notice stating that the home shopping channel will not be available on the platform from 1 December.
Apart from Best Deal TV, Telugu movie channel Studio One will cease to be on the platform from 1 December due to the expiry of contract. Similarly, devotional channel Win TV will be removed from the platform due to default of payment by the broadcaster. Reliance Digital TV currently has 4.9 million subscribers with 6 per cent share of the DTH market in India
